The ability to know exactly which parts of a tree to remove and which to leave alone is a critical skill for tree surgeons, built on training and real-world experience. A misjudged cut in the wrong area can create more problems than solutions, leaving the tree susceptible to decay or infection. The more experienced tree surgeons in High Wycombe will always start by checking the tree, explaining what they are planning, and doing it in a way that helps the tree heal properly and keep growing well.

Permission

If the tree is protected by a Tree Preservation Order or within a conservation area, you will often need permission before doing any work on it. A professional tree surgeon will take care of all the formalities, helping with the paperwork and ensuring that everything is done above board and correctly. When things get close to property edges or shared paths, they'll know exactly how to keep within the rules and still get the job done.

Qualifications and Insurance

When hiring a tree surgeon, it's vital to check their credentials - are they fully insured and qualified? You want to ensure that you're hiring someone who is competent and trustworthy. You should search for somebody who holds certifications such as LANTRA or NPTC, and it's worth checking whether they belong to reputable organisations like the Arboricultural Association. Look for a solid reputation, accurate paperwork, and upfront clarity in the quote - these all signal that you're dealing with someone serious about their work.
